Lamborghini Concept S Up for Auction

Though their upcoming auction in Monterey, California may be headlining most news stories, RM Sotheby’s is saving a piece of Lamborghini history for their New York Auction: the Lamborghini Concept S.If you don’t mind arriving with a unique hairstyle, this Gallardo’s lack of a functional windshield is a throwback to vintage open-air motoring. As the lot description on RM Sotheby's Auctions website tells us, a rolling chassis was shown at Geneva in 2005 to gauge public interest in a Gallardo speedster. The crowd and the motoring press went wild, so it received a few more styling touches along with a functional drivetrain. All aspects of the car were made ready for a limited production run, but it never came to fruition.(Related: $65 Million Car Collection Walk-Around: The Pinnacle Portfolio)With one owner since new, the street legal Concept S has seen just over 111 miles of engineering shakedowns and Concours fields. Keith Richards' Bentley "Blue Lena" Set for Auction at Bo...

Summer 2015 is turning into one of the best seasons yet for adding rare, collectible and iconic vehicles to collections, with auction houses left and right lining up some incredible lots.Bonhams has recently listed one particularly notorious Bentley. "Blue Lena," after Lena Horne, was its nickname when Keith Richards owned this 1965 S3 Continental Flying Spur Sports Saloon, and as recently as June 7, 2013, when a Soundcloud recording was added to KeithRichards.com, it was still in his garage.With an owner like Keith Richards, there are few doubts that this particular Bentley has seen more wild things than most humans could ever imagine. There are references to Blue Lena throughout Richards' autobiography "Life," including the time he drove down to Morocco to find some things that are illegal in most countries.There are reports that it was modified to add a hidden compartment for the things they didn't want police to find, and Car and Driver's July 8 article tells us he bought it new when he was 22. But after about 50 years of ownership, it's time for Lena to find a new home.(See Also: Miami Vice's Ferrari Testarossa Set to Cross the Block at Mecum)Bonhams is estimating the lot will sell for between $610,000 and $920,000 at the September 12 Goodwood Revival auction in Chichester, Goodwood, UK. Auctions America Santa Monica: 300 Rare Cars Set to Cross...

What do a Ferrari Enzo, a custom Bubbletop Ford, Rita Hayworth's 1941 Continental Coupe and a 1954 Sorrell-Manning Special all have in common? 1955 Ford "Beatnik Bubbletop" CustomThey'll be crossing an auction block and finding new owners in Santa Monica next week.On July 17 and 18, approximately 300 hand-selected cars will assemble at Santa Monica's historic Barker Hangar for Auctions America's annual California Sale. Owned by presidents, celebrities and private collectors alike, each represents a distinct point in automotive history, capturing the essence of a different era in their design and construction.Among the main highlights found in the Auctions America event are a few rare Ferraris, Porsches and Mercedes-Benz models, as well as some radiantly beautiful custom designs. A 2004 Enzo is estimated to sell for between $1,700,000 and $2,100,000, while an older Prancing Horse, a 1967 330 GTS, could go for anywhere between $2 million to $2.6 million. The 1938 Mercedes-Benz 540K Special RoadsterFrom Mercedes-Benz is a 1938 540K Special Roadster by Nawrocki. Considered a supercar at the time of its production, the 540K Special Roadster is an incredibly rare model, as only 58 examples were created. As Car and Driver stated back in May 2002, a 1937 540K sold for $3.6 million, which, when adjusted for inflation, amounts to around $4.75 million. With the rate at which the values of collector cars has increased over the past few years, there's no doubt that this will fetch an incredibly high price. Estimates for this specific Roadster are set for $2+ million.In the truly unique category are the 1955 Ford "Beatnik Bubbletop" Custom and a few vehicles who were once owned by a person of note, including President Kennedy's 1962 Lincoln Continental Presidential Town Limousine, George M.
